What Does a Probate Lawyer Do?

Picture




























​​Taking care of the loss of a loved one can be a mentally challenging time. Sadly, in addition to the grieving process, there are lawful matters that require to be resolved. This is where a probate attorney can come in to help and direct you through the intricate procedure of probate.

So, exactly what does a probate attorney do? In straightforward terms, a probate legal representative focuses on the legal elements of administering a deceased person's estate. They are fluent in probate regulations and can give useful insight and guidance throughout the probate procedure.

Among the key duties of a probate attorney is to assist the administrator of the estate navigate the legal procedure efficiently. Administrators are in charge of handling and distributing the assets and property of the deceased according to their will certainly or, if there is no will, according to the state's intestacy legislations. A probate lawyer can assist the administrator in fulfilling their responsibilities and making sure that the estate is dealt with properly.

Along with guiding the executor, an estate planning attorney can additionally help in numerous other tasks. This might include filing the necessary legal documents with the court, alerting creditors and recipients, valuing the estate, dealing with disagreements, paying tax obligations, and dispersing possessions. They can also provide advice on minimizing estate taxes and securing assets.

It is essential to understand that probate legislations can differ from one state to another, so having a probate attorney who is well-versed in the details regulations of your territory is essential. Their know-how can assist guarantee that all legal demands are fulfilled, reducing the risk of potential obstacles or disagreements during the probate process.

To conclude, a probate attorney plays a crucial duty in guiding the executor and guaranteeing that the estate is worked out according to the dead individual's wishes and appropriate regulations.
